If there is a large amount of bleeding after cerebral hemorrhage surgery, coma may occur. If bleeding occurs in the upper and lower nerves, it may lead to hemiplegia, sensory disturbance, hemiblindness and other sequelae. If bleeding occurs in the left frontal lobe, temporal lobe and other parts, it may also lead to speech dysfunction.
